Pelicans' Losing Streak Extends to Eight Games as Dallas Beats New Orleans 118-115
Cooper Flagg’s 29 points led Dallas to a 118-115 win over New Orleans as the Mavericks improved to 1-2 in NBA Cup play with key late free throws and defense.
- On Friday night at American Airlines Center, the Dallas Mavericks beat the New Orleans Pelicans 118-115 as Naji Marshall hit a go-ahead 3-pointer with 30.7 seconds left, while Cooper Flagg scored a career-high 29 points.
- After missing the previous game with illness, Flagg led the Mavericks' comeback, rallying from a 53-38 deficit with a 26-11 run and tying the score at 85 entering the fourth quarter.
- In the final minutes, Flagg scored six points and had two assists, including on Marshall's go-ahead 3, while Christie made two free throws after Washington blocked a 3.
- In clutch-game terms, Dallas improved to 4-9 after forcing New Orleans into two 3-point misses, while the Pelicans dropped to 2-14 and 0-4 under interim coach James Borrego.
- Looking ahead at the schedule, the Dallas Mavericks face a tough stretch with next 11 opponents combined 93-55 and must manage seven of next 10 games on the road after struggling 3-8 at American Airlines Center.
